Former Indian cricketer Irfan Pathan has speculated on whether India will include left-arm pacer Arshdeep Singh in their Super Four clash against Pakistan in the Asia Cup 2025 on Sunday, September 21. Pathan expressed that he would opt for Arshdeep, but noted that Indian captain Suryakumar Yadav and the team management might consider other options.
India will face their arch-rivals in the second Super Four match at the Dubai International Cricket Stadium. In the first Super Four game at the same venue a day earlier, Bangladesh defeated Sri Lanka by four wickets. Pathan made these observations while discussing India’s likely bowling attack for the clash against Pakistan.
"I will stick to my words, what I said before the start of the Asia Cup. I would want to see Arshdeep play with (Jasprit) Bumrah because a situation could come where you might need a second fast bowler. When the ball gets wet and you are under pressure, is Hardik's (Pandya) strength bowling six yorkers, or can Shivam Dube bowl those yorkers consistently?," Pathan said on Sony Sports.
“There will be a question there. That's why, can you think about Arshdeep? However, it's difficult to change a team that's been playing and winning. You wouldn't want to play a batter less as well. It's a tough decision. I would have done differently, but the team is thinking differently," he added.

In the same discussion, former Indian assistant coach Abhishek Nayar raised the question of whether India would stick with the same playing XI that featured in their first two games of the Asia Cup.
"It seems like that. Varun Chakaravarthy will return. You will see that one change for sure. However, it will have to be seen whether they will play with Arshdeep or get in another batter. I feel they will have the same team that was playing earlier. You won't see too many changes," Nayar said.
"Spin bowlers have had an impact in Dubai. Bumrah will return and Hardik, who is bowling well, is there. So do you need a third seamer? Dube hasn't bowled badly at all thus far. He has played his role. He will definitely give you one or two overs. So, if you see the overall formation of that team, it's right for these conditions," he concluded.
Arshdeep was not part of India’s playing XI in the group match against Pakistan on September 14, which the Men in Blue won by seven wickets. The left-arm pacer had returned figures of 1/37 in his four-over spell in India’s last group game against Oman in Abu Dhabi on Friday, September 19.
